WebMiralax – Miralax, a tasteless laxative that can be purchased at your local pharmacy and given to your pup to help with constipation. Miralax works by helping to bring water back into the intestinal tract to get things moving. A good general rule is to mix it into your dog’s food twice daily. WebMar 24, 2024 · A simple way to increase your dog’s fiber intake is by feeding them pumpkins. Pumpkin is high in both soluble and insoluble fiber, which helps keep the digestive system functioning properly. Usually, … can dogs eat granola oatsWebJun 6, 2024 · The most common cause of constipation in dogs is swallowing objects that are not easily digested, such as bones, grass or hair. Other causes include lack of fibre, lack of exercise, blocked anal glands, certain intestinal problems, trauma to the pelvis an enlarged prostate, kidney disease or hernias.
